0.168 in Words
0.168 is a positive terminating decimal less than 1. It has 3 decimal places, and its final digit is in the thousandths place.
Direct Answer
0.168 in words is zero point one six eight.
0.168 Place-Value Breakdown
The decimal digits place 1 in the tenth place, 6 in the hundredth place, and 8 in the thousandth place.
| Part | Digit | Place | Digit value |
|---|---|---|---|
| Whole part | 0 | ones | 0 |
| Decimal part | 1 | tenth | 1/10 |
| Decimal part | 6 | hundredth | 6/100 |
| Decimal part | 8 | thousandth | 8/1000 |

Expanded Form of 0.168
0.168 = 1/10 + 6/100 + 8/1000
0.168 = 0 + 168/1000
The final nonzero digit is in the thousandths place, so its value is expressed with a denominator of 1000.
How 0.168 Simplifies to 21/125
0.168 = 168/1000
The greatest common divisor of 168 and 1000 is 8.
168 ÷ 8 = 21
1000 ÷ 8 = 125
Therefore, 168/1000 = 21/125.
0.168 as a Percentage
To convert 0.168 to a percentage, multiply it by 100.
0.168 × 100 = 16.8
Therefore, 0.168 = 16.8%.
Decimals Equivalent to 0.168
0.168 = 0.1680 = 0.16800
Adding zeros to the right of a decimal does not change its numerical value. It does change the number of written decimal places and may communicate different precision.
| Decimal | Final place | Exact fraction | Simplified value |
|---|---|---|---|
| 0.168 | thousandths | 168/1000 | 21/125 |
| 0.1680 | ten-thousandths | 1680/10000 | 21/125 |
| 0.16800 | hundred-thousandths | 16800/100000 | 21/125 |
